Overview

TB Service is the public-facing counterpart to the Projects Portal: a platform for small works and reactive maintenance. Where refurbishment projects run for months, service jobs arrive unpredictably and need a contractor on site quickly — a scheduling problem more than a documentation one.

The system takes incoming service requests, auto-schedules them against available contractors, tracks each job end to end, and generates client invoices automatically on completion.

The scheduling engine

The core of the product is matching: each incoming request has a trade, a location, and an urgency; each contractor has skills, availability, and a working area. The scheduler proposes assignments automatically and lets the operations team confirm or override — automation with a human in the loop, rather than a black box.

Closing the loop

Because the system knows what was requested, who did the work, and when it completed, invoicing becomes a by-product rather than a chore: invoices generate from job records and go to the client without manual re-entry. Clients get the same transparency as the ops team — request status, scheduled visits, and history in one place.
